Reptar shows its age by its very name (taken from the “Rugrats” cartoon). That’s beside the point. This Georgia quartet incorporates electronics with mildly odd vocals, adds dance beats with afrocentric grooves and underlays it all with an upbeat pop attitude for the debut EP, “Oblangle Fizz Y’All”. I don’t care if I can’t understand half the lyrics. I like it anyway. Rebecca RuthROBERT POLLARD
